swaggie
n 1: an itinerant Australian laborer who carries his personal
belongings in a bundle as he travels around in search of
work [synonym: {swagman}, {swagger}, {swaggie}]

  • Swagman - Wikipedia
    A swagman (also called a swaggie, sundowner or tussocker) was a transient labourer who travelled by foot from farm to farm carrying his belongings in a swag The term originated in Australia in the 19th century and was later used in New Zealand

  • swaggie, n. meanings, etymology and more | Oxford English Dictionary
    There is one meaning in OED's entry for the noun swaggie See ‘Meaning use’ for definition, usage, and quotation evidence This word is used in Australian English and New Zealand English OED's earliest evidence for swaggie is from 1884, in Kerang Times Swanhill Gazette (Victoria, Australia)
